Introduction to Nairai Island and Its Transportation Challenges

Nairai Island, part of Fiji’s Lomaiviti archipelago, is a hidden gem offering stunning landscapes and rich cultural experiences. The Current State of Infrastructure on Nairai Island

The existing infrastructure on Nairai Island is limited, with transportation options primarily consisting of small boats and the occasional chartered flight. Roads are often unpaved and in poor condition, making travel within the island difficult. This lack of reliable transportation infrastructure not only affects residents but also deters tourists seeking adventure travel Nairai experiences. Improving these facilities is essential for fostering economic growth and enhancing the quality of life for the local population.

Efforts to Improve Maritime Access

Given the island’s reliance on maritime transport, enhancing its ports and docking facilities is a priority. Recent initiatives have focused on upgrading existing docks and constructing new ones to accommodate larger vessels. These improvements aim to increase the frequency and reliability of ferry services, which are vital for both residents and tourists.
